#2 L’Assemblée représentative Moebius variations sketch on the floor, unsaved conversation 20mn -researches for the art_politic research program SPEAP by Bruno Latour, Sciences Po Paris, supporting by Stephan Neuwirth researcher of the mathematical laboratory of Besancon, 2014. -save delete cancel, 2016, Beton7 gallery, Athens On the subject of the representative assembly I studied a mathematical object: The Moebius strip, conceived by human, this object owns only one face and one edge. I imagined the diferent variations of this mathematical object, provoked by the foor universal forces ( magnetism, gravity, strong and weak nuclear interactions). By this way I try to confront an ideal, a theorical harmony against the rigourous conventions of our reality to figure out its constrains and its skills.

During a research residency in the Saline Royale, I worked on the ideal architecture and links wich can exist with a spontaneous architecture. Studying architectural structure of the ideal factory made by Claude Nicolas Ledoux in 17 th century, I present on this trial similarities with the law of radioactivity and particulary with the Teller Ulam’s bomb, nuclear weapon.
